Lynden Duncombe (or really just “Lynden”), is South Andros Island’s local “Shell Man” and keeper of dock at Little Creek, where we launch our boats at Andros South. Lynden has what’s known as a “Stall” that he licenses annually with the local government. He sells a wide variety of local shells, and sometimes jewelry and other gifts. He’s fully open to…

Jim Reinertsen has been chasing bonefish on South Andros Island for years. He’s learned some tricks of the trade during that time, including this little secret: more big fish get caught during the winter.
